Olga Boznańska was a prominent Polish painter known for her distinctive style and contribution to the art world during the late 19th and early 20th centuries. One of her notable works is the "Portrait of Maria Koźniewska-Kalinowska," which exemplifies her skill in capturing the essence and character of her subjects through portraiture.

Olga Boznańska was born on April 15, 1865, in Kraków, Poland, and she became one of the most celebrated Polish artists of her time. She was known for her portraits, which often featured a subdued color palette and a focus on the psychological depth of her subjects. Boznańska's work was influenced by the Impressionist movement, yet she developed a unique style that set her apart from her contemporaries.

The "Portrait of Maria Koźniewska-Kalinowska" is a testament to Boznańska's ability to convey the inner life of her subjects. Maria Koźniewska-Kalinowska was a figure of some prominence, although specific details about her life and her relationship with Boznańska are not extensively documented. The portrait is characterized by Boznańska's typical use of muted colors and soft brushwork, which create a sense of intimacy and introspection.

Boznańska's technique often involved a careful layering of paint, allowing her to achieve a depth and richness in her portraits that brought her subjects to life. In this particular portrait, the artist's attention to detail is evident in the delicate rendering of facial features and the subtle play of light and shadow. Boznańska had a remarkable ability to capture the mood and personality of her sitters, and this portrait is no exception.

The background of the painting is typically understated, a common feature in Boznańska's work, which serves to draw the viewer's attention to the subject's face and expression. This focus on the sitter's visage allows the viewer to engage directly with the subject, fostering a sense of connection and empathy.

Olga Boznańska's portraits were highly regarded during her lifetime, and she received numerous accolades for her work. She exhibited widely across Europe, and her paintings were included in prestigious collections and exhibitions. Her contribution to the art world was recognized with various awards and honors, and she remains an important figure in Polish art history.

The "Portrait of Maria Koźniewska-Kalinowska" is a fine example of Boznańska's artistic legacy. It reflects her mastery of portraiture and her ability to convey the complexity of human emotion through her art. Today, Boznańska's works are held in high esteem, and her portraits continue to be studied and admired for their technical skill and emotional depth.

In summary, Olga Boznańska's "Portrait of Maria Koźniewska-Kalinowska" is a significant work that highlights the artist's talent for capturing the psychological essence of her subjects. Through her distinctive style and approach to portraiture, Boznańska has secured her place as one of Poland's most esteemed artists, and her works continue to be celebrated for their contribution to the art world.
